Planning ahead is a great way to score big savings, as Royal Caribbean often runs early saver deals to guests booking well in advance. It’s also pretty safe to assume prices usually go up as availability goes down the closer you get to your sail date, so booking ahead is a surefire way to lock in a great rate. That said, booking a cruise at the last minute can also yield some unexpected savings — but only if the itinerary you’re interested in hasn’t sold out yet. When people think of the most romantic destinations in the Mexican Riviera, Puerto Vallarta is usually the first place that comes to mind.

Its botanic gardens are famous, encompassing 63 acres of unique flora and fauna. And its street food scene rivals that of the world’s top culinary capitals — just try some tasty tacos al pastor and you’ll probably agree. Another great way to spend your day in Puerto Vallarta is horseback riding through the Sierra Madre rainforest in search of glittering waterfalls and rivers.

The best way to get around in Los Angeles is by car, as there aren’t many public transportation options that will take you all around the city. The bus system has several routes, but it’s important to account for traffic delays, no matter what form of transportation you choose. Therefore, booking a shore excursion is a smart way to guarantee that you’ll arrive at your ship on time. Escape the hustle and bustle of LA and drive up the coast to the laid-back city of Malibu. Catalina Island has long been a favorite spot to escape the bustle of LA. With its scenic hiking trails, pretty sailboat-studded bays, and quaint, Mediterranean charm, it’s the perfect destination to soak up the sunshine and slip into a vacation state of mind.
